A robust study on fractional order HIV/AIDS model by using numerical methods

Tasmia Roshan,
Surath Ghosh,
Ram P. Chauhan
et al.

Abstract: PurposeThe fractional order HIV model has an important role in biological science. To study the HIV model in a better way, the model is presented with the help of Atangana- Baleanu operator which is in Caputo sense. Also, the characteristics of the solutions are described briefly with the help of the advance numerical techniques for the different values of fractional order derivatives. This paper aims to discuss the aforementioned objectives.Design/methodology/approachIn this work, Adams-Bashforth method and E… Show more
